| Bruce <bruce@invalid.invalid>: Mar 06 06:26AM +1100 >> soon. That might sound like a vegetarian nightmare, but they can be >> quite good. >I'd like to hear about that. Tell us a story. I only made them once before so far. I probably got this from the Internet: Nutburgers Group 1: 115 gr walnut, 100 gr almond, 75 gr cashew, 1 clove of garlic, big pinch of salt; food process Group2: 1 tbsp ketchup, 1 tbsp soy sauce, 3 tbsp, nutritional yeast, ΕΊ tsp mixed herbs, small carrot, small zuchini, 60 gr rolled oats; food process; make paddies, pan fry They were a bit wet, so I'll add a bit more oats next time. Also some chilli pepper and a bit more garlic. |
